What Are Remote Medical Assistant Jobs?

What Are Remote Medical Assistant Jobs

Remote medical assistant jobs are healthcare support roles performed outside a traditional medical office. 

Instead of working on-site, medical assistants complete their tasks using computers, phones, and healthcare software.

In remote medical assistant jobs, professionals help doctors, nurses, and healthcare teams by handling administrative and communication tasks.

 These roles are essential in keeping healthcare operations running smoothly.

Remote medical assistant jobs are common in telehealth services, private practices, clinics, and healthcare organizations.

Common Responsibilities in Remote Medical Assistant Jobs

Administrative Support Tasks

Most remote medical assistant jobs focus on administrative duties. These tasks help reduce the workload of in-office staff and improve patient service.

Common tasks include:

  • Scheduling appointments
  • Managing patient records
  • Updating electronic health information
  • Handling billing and insurance claims

Patient Communication

Remote medical assistant jobs often involve direct communication with patients. Assistants answer calls, respond to messages, and provide basic information.

Patient communication tasks may include:

  • Appointment reminders
  • Follow-up calls
  • Explaining procedures
  • Answering general questions

Telehealth Support

With the rise of virtual care, remote medical assistant jobs support telehealth appointments. Assistants help prepare sessions, guide patients, and manage documentation.

Skills Needed for Remote Medical Assistant Jobs

Medical Knowledge and Terminology

Remote medical assistant jobs require basic medical knowledge. Understanding medical terms helps assistants communicate accurately and complete documentation correctly.

Communication Skills

Clear and professional communication is essential. Remote medical assistant jobs involve talking to patients, doctors, and insurance providers daily.

Computer and Technical Skills

Since all tasks are done online, remote medical assistant jobs require strong computer skills. Familiarity with healthcare software and digital tools is important.

Time Management and Organization

Working remotely requires self-discipline. Successful professionals in remote medical assistant jobs manage their time well and stay organized without direct supervision.

Education and Training for Remote Medical Assistant Jobs

Most remote medical assistant jobs require a high school diploma or equivalent. Many employers prefer candidates with medical assistant training or certification.

Training programs teach:

  • Medical terminology
  • Healthcare administration
  • Patient communication
  • Electronic health records

Some remote medical assistant jobs offer on-the-job training, especially for entry-level roles.

Challenges of Remote Medical Assistant Jobs

Limited Hands-On Clinical Work

Remote medical assistant jobs focus mainly on administrative tasks. Those who prefer clinical work may find this limiting.

Technical Requirements

Reliable internet, a computer, and secure systems are essential. Technical issues can affect productivity in remote medical assistant jobs.

Maintaining Patient Privacy

Remote medical assistant jobs require strict attention to patient privacy. Following healthcare regulations is critical when working remotely.

Types of Remote Medical Assistant Jobs

Virtual Medical Assistant

Virtual medical assistants provide full administrative support remotely. They manage schedules, records, and communication.

Telehealth Medical Assistant

These professionals support online appointments and assist patients during virtual visits.

Insurance and Billing Assistant

Some remote medical assistant jobs focus on billing, claims processing, and insurance verification.

Specialty Medical Assistant Roles

Certain remote medical assistant jobs specialize in fields such as mental health, dermatology, or pediatrics.
